Identifying Yersinia YopH-targeted signal transduction pathways that impair neutrophil responses during in vivo murine infection
Identifying molecular targets of Yersinia virulence effectors, or Yops, during animal infection is challenging because few cells are targeted by Yops in an infected organ and isolating these sparse effector-containing cells is difficult. YopH, a tyrosine phosphatase, is essential for full virulence...
